LED製造設備支援用於通用照明、汽車照明、顯示器、標誌、園藝、背光、紫外線應用以及新興微型LED架構的發光二極體的生產。設備涵蓋外延系統、晶圓加工設備、微影術、蝕刻、沉積、焊線、磷光體塗層、封裝、測試、分類、檢測和自動化封裝等領域。隨著對更高發光效率、更小尺寸、更佳色彩均勻性、更高良率和更低功耗的需求不斷成長,製造商被迫對其製造和封裝生產線進行現代化改造。從傳統LED構裝到晶片級封裝、迷你LED背光、微型LED顯示器、UV-C裝置和高功率汽車模組的轉變,增加了生產流程的技術複雜性。因此,負責人優先考慮那些能夠支援更嚴格的製程控制、先進測量技術、無塵室相容性、自動化整合以及跨多種裝置類型靈活切換的設備。此外,由於LED製造依賴高能耗的外延生長、精密材料和高通量測試,永續性正成為採購決策的核心因素。因此,產業相關人員不僅關注擴大產能,還關注製程效率、材料利用率、缺陷減少、全生命週期生產力以及合規性。

一項變革性的變革,將徹底改變LED生產設備的格局。

LED生產設備的格局正受到三大結構性變革的重塑:裝置小型化、製造自動化和應用多元化。與傳統LED構裝相比,MiniLED和microLED架構對晶圓檢測、批次傳輸、鍵結、修復和像素級測試的精確度要求更高。這推動了先進光學檢測、自動化處理、雷射加工和高精度貼裝系統的應用。同時,製造商正從勞動密集的獨立組裝流程轉向整合生產單元,這些單元融合了機器人、機器視覺、即時數據採集和線上品管等技術。應用多元化也改變了對設備的要求。汽車照明需要可靠性、散熱性能、功能安全標準和可追溯性。顯示應用需要均勻性和缺陷控制。紫外線LED需要特殊的材料和封裝。園藝照明則強調光譜控制和能源效率。供應鏈的韌性也是一個關鍵決定因素,製造商會評估設備的可用性、備件支援、在地化方案和服務網路。環境法規和能源效率政策繼續推動全球範圍內的 LED 普及,但設備採購決策越來越受到製程能力、總擁有成本 (TCO)、運轉率以及與下一代設備藍圖的兼容性的影響。

人工智慧對LED製造的累積影響

人工智慧 (AI) 正日益成為 LED 生產設備整體的驅動力,尤其是在偵測、製程最佳化、預測性維護和良率提升方面。基於檢驗的生產資料訓練的 AI 驅動的機器視覺,能夠比人工檢測更穩定地識別晶圓缺陷、顏色不一致、鍵結失效、污染和封裝異常。在晶圓外延和加工過程中,機器學習模型分析感測器輸出和製程歷史,有助於更精確地控制溫度、氣體流量、薄膜均勻性和缺陷密度。在封裝和組裝過程中,AI 可以最佳化晶片放置、鍵合參數、點膠量、固化曲線以及基於測試的分級決策。預測性維護演算法透過監測振動、溫度、真空穩定性、運作精度和設備使用模式,有助於減少意外停機時間。 AI 還能將程式參數與最終裝置的效能關聯起來,從而增強可追溯性,並在良率下降時加快根本原因分析。然而,成功實施 AI 技術需要高品質的資料管治、校準的感測器、強大的網路安全、可互通的製造執行系統以及人工監督。人工智慧的累積影響遠不止於簡單的自動化;它將 LED 生產線轉變為能夠從製程變異中學習並提高大規模生產一致性的自適應系統。

LED production equipment underpins the manufacturing of light-emitting diodes used in general lighting, automotive lighting, displays, signage, horticulture, backlighting, UV applications, and emerging microLED architectures. The equipment landscape spans epitaxy systems, wafer processing tools, lithography, etching, deposition, die bonding, wire bonding, phosphor coating, encapsulation, testing, sorting, inspection, and packaging automation. Demand for higher luminous efficacy, smaller form factors, improved color uniformity, higher yields, and lower energy consumption is pushing manufacturers to modernize fabrication and packaging lines. The transition from conventional LED packages to chip-scale packages, miniLED backlights, microLED displays, UV-C devices, and high-power automotive modules is increasing the technical complexity of production workflows. As a result, buyers are prioritizing equipment that supports tighter process control, advanced metrology, cleanroom compatibility, automation integration, and flexible changeovers across multiple device types. Sustainability is also becoming central to procurement decisions, as LED manufacturing relies on energy-intensive epitaxy, precision materials, and high-throughput testing. Industry stakeholders are therefore focusing on process efficiency, material utilization, defect reduction, lifecycle productivity, and regulatory alignment rather than capacity expansion alone.

Transformative Shifts Reshaping LED Production Equipment

The LED production equipment landscape is being reshaped by three structural shifts: device miniaturization, manufacturing automation, and application diversification. MiniLED and microLED architectures require substantially higher precision in wafer inspection, mass transfer, bonding, repair, and pixel-level testing compared with conventional LED packages. This is driving adoption of advanced optical inspection, automated handling, laser-based processing, and high-accuracy placement systems. In parallel, manufacturers are moving from discrete, labor-intensive assembly steps toward integrated production cells that combine robotics, machine vision, real-time data capture, and inline quality control. Application diversification is also changing equipment requirements. Automotive lighting demands reliability, thermal performance, functional safety discipline, and traceability; display applications require uniformity and defect management; UV LEDs require specialized materials and packaging; and horticulture lighting emphasizes spectral control and energy efficiency. Supply chain resilience has become another defining factor, with manufacturers evaluating equipment availability, spare parts support, localization options, and service networks. Environmental regulation and energy-efficiency policies continue to support LED adoption globally, while equipment purchasing decisions are increasingly shaped by process capability, total cost of ownership, uptime, and compatibility with next-generation device roadmaps.

Cumulative Impact of Artificial Intelligence on LED Manufacturing

Artificial intelligence is becoming a practical enabler across LED production equipment, especially in inspection, process optimization, predictive maintenance, and yield improvement. AI-enabled machine vision can identify wafer defects, color inconsistencies, bonding failures, contamination, and packaging anomalies more consistently than manual inspection when trained on validated production data. In epitaxy and wafer processing, machine learning models can support tighter control of temperature, gas flow, film uniformity, and defect density by analyzing sensor outputs and process histories. In packaging and assembly, AI can optimize die placement, bonding parameters, dispensing volumes, curing profiles, and test binning decisions. Predictive maintenance algorithms help reduce unplanned downtime by monitoring vibration, temperature, vacuum stability, motion accuracy, and tool utilization patterns. AI also strengthens traceability by linking process parameters to final device performance, enabling faster root-cause analysis when yield loss occurs. However, successful deployment requires high-quality data governance, calibrated sensors, robust cybersecurity, interoperable manufacturing execution systems, and human oversight. The cumulative impact of AI is not merely automation; it is a shift toward adaptive LED manufacturing lines capable of learning from process variation and improving consistency across high-volume production.

Actionable Recommendations for LED Production Equipment Leaders

Industry leaders should align equipment investment with next-generation LED device roadmaps rather than short-term production needs alone. Priority actions include upgrading inline inspection and metrology, integrating AI-enabled process analytics, improving equipment interoperability with manufacturing execution systems, and strengthening preventive and predictive maintenance programs. Manufacturers should evaluate total cost of ownership by considering uptime, throughput stability, material utilization, energy consumption, spare parts availability, and service response times. For miniLED and microLED applications, leaders should focus on mass transfer accuracy, repair capability, defect mapping, bonding precision, and pixel-level testing. For automotive and industrial applications, they should prioritize traceability, thermal process control, reliability testing, and compliance documentation. Supply chain resilience can be improved through dual sourcing of critical components, regional service partnerships, and standardized equipment platforms that can be adapted across product lines. Sustainability initiatives should target reduced scrap, lower power consumption, optimized gas and chemical usage, water efficiency, and recyclable packaging materials. Workforce readiness is equally important; operators, engineers, and maintenance teams require training in automation, data analytics, cleanroom discipline, and advanced quality systems to fully capture the benefits of modern LED production equipment.
